How much do building support technician j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for building support technician in the United States is $25.07,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.67 and $28.37 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How to become a building support technician?

To become a building support technician,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, along with technical knowledge of building systems such as HVAC, electrical, or plumbing. Relevant skills include troubleshooting, maintenance, and familiarity with tools and safety procedures; some roles may require certifications like OSHA or specific trade licenses. Gaining experience through apprenticeships or entry-level maintenance positions can also be beneficial.

What do building support technicians do?

Building support technicians are responsible for maintaining and repairing building systems such as electrical, plumbing, HVAC, and security. They perform inspections, troubleshoot issues, and ensure that facilities operate safely and efficiently, often using tools like diagnostic equipment and following safety protocols.
